SWEPT OFF THE WHARF.
9 (By Teleurauh-Press Association.) Napier, April 27. An inquest on Henry Hollaed, the young man who was swept off the wharf and drowned yesterday afternoon, was opened to-day, and adjourned for a fortnight, to permit of evidence being tendered as to tho ofHcioney of tho lifesaving appliances at the breakwater, and as to whether due precautions were taken to prevent jKjople going on the wharf during tie height of the -gtotm.
